About Friends of the Earth

Friends of the Earth (FoE) is a bold, progressive environmental organisation with a global legacy of more than five decades of impactful advocacy.

Known for its principled and unapologetic approach, Friends of the Earth works at the intersection of environmental protection, economic justice, and social equity, challenging systems that harm people and the planet.

As part of Friends of the Earth International, a federation active in over 70 countries, the organisation collaborates across borders to address urgent global challenges, including climate change, environmental injustice, and corporate accountability. Friends of the Earth is deeply committed to transforming how societies value people, communities, and the natural world.
